WebNov 17, 2024 · By contrast, a cut-through switch may forward invalid frames because no FCS check is performed. Cut-Through Switching (1.2.1.5) An advantage to cut-through switching is the capability of the switch to start forwarding a frame earlier than store-and-forward switching. There are two primary characteristics of cut-through switching: rapid … WebMar 10, 2024 · The main difference between them is: Store-and-Forward switch makes the decision after the whole packet has been received. Cut-Through switch makes a forwarding decision after analyzing the destination MAC address, which is in the first part of the frame. You might get anything between 200~400Mbps on ARM devices. fxdz-20x62beg3WebOct 18, 2024 · Cut-through is a packet-switching method, where the switch forwards a packet as soon as the destination address is processed without waiting for the entire … fxdz-2305bg5WebApr 21, 2014 · Cut-through switching is a switching method used in packet-switching systems where the switch forwards packets or frames to its destination immediately after … atkinson rd killeenWebBy default, all FortiSwitch models use the store-and-forward technique to forward packets. This technique waits until the entire packet is received, verifies the content, and then forwards the packet.
